Restrictions on indirect costs refer to limitations placed on the amount of indirect costs that can be allocated to a specific project or funding source.
Organizations receiving funding that have restrictions on indirect costs in their grant agreement are required to file restrictions on indirect costs.
Restrictions on indirect costs can be filled out by providing detailed information on the allocation of indirect costs for a specific project or funding source.
The purpose of restrictions on indirect costs is to ensure that indirect costs are allocated appropriately and in compliance with grant agreements.
Information such as the total amount of indirect costs, the specific project or funding source to which the indirect costs are allocated, and any limitations or restrictions on the allocation of indirect costs must be reported.
